As certified advanced practice nurses, Psychiatric Nurse Practitioners provide a range of mental health treatment and support services to patients and their families. As nurses, they may be exposed to patients with infectious diseases and, as psychiatric caregivers, they are at risk for injury when treating patients who may become violent or emotionally agitated. According to the American Psychological Association, a psychiatric nurse practitioner is a medical professional who holds an advanced practice nursing degree and works in a variety of settings with individuals with varying levels of mental illness.In this specialty, the nurse works with individuals, groups, and families to help manage both common and complex mental health disorders. Credential Awarded: PMHNP-BC (Formerly known as Family Psychiatric–Mental Health Nurse Practitioner) The ANCC Psychiatric-Mental Health Nurse Practitioner board certification examination is a competency based examination that provides a valid and reliable assessment of the entry-level clinical knowledge and skills of nurse practitioners.
